§ 46-3-453 - Change of name by foreign electric cooperative

O.C.G.A. 46-3-453 (2010)
46-3-453. Change of name by foreign electric cooperative


Whenever a foreign electric cooperative which is authorized to transact business in this state changes its name, such foreign electric cooperative shall, within 30 days after such change becomes effective, file an application for an amended certificate of authority in accordance with Code Section 46-3-462. If the foreign electric cooperative fails to file this application or if the name to which it has changed would be unavailable to the foreign electric cooperative on an original application for a certificate of authority, the certificate of authority of such foreign electric cooperative shall be suspended and it shall not thereafter transact any business in this state until it has filed the application or has changed its name to a name which is available to it under the laws of this state.
